DTC CHECK / CLEAR
DTC CHECK
(a) Connect the Techstream to the DLC3.
(b) Turn the power switch on (IG).
(c) Turn the Techstream on.
(d) Enter the following menus: Body Electrical / Vehicle Proximity Notification System / Trouble Codes.
Body Electrical > Vehicle Proximity Notification System > Trouble Codes
(e) Check for DTCs.
DTC CLEAR
(a) Connect the Techstream to the DLC3.
(b) Turn the power switch on (IG).
(c) Turn the Techstream on.
(d) Enter the following menus: Body Electrical / Vehicle Proximity Notification System / Trouble Codes.
Body Electrical > Vehicle Proximity Notification System > Clear DTCs
(e) Clear the DTCs.
